Feedback / Comment from Compass - Director HR, Irene Zeller 4.12.2017. We take the feedback and suggestions of our employees seriously. But we prefer channels like Speak-Up (internal) - because we would like to take a stand and understand the concrete situation. We offer candidates to send their feedback to the respective contact person or directly to me: irene.zeller@compass-group.ch The market's not sleeping, but we're better! We will win with our great employees and our strategic approach of focusing more on culinary delights and people. A caterer from Baar wrote in an advertisement last week: "bad earnings, no team and a bad-tempered boss" and received more than 50 good applications. Let's face it, we have many local base salaries. We can and will probably never be able to keep up with other industries. Our culture is based on constructive cooperation and we reward and appreciate exceptional performance with bonuses, special bonuses and as much appreciation as possible. We want every one of us to work every day with pleasure and pleasure. What is important to us, however, is that we look together in the companies and at the SC to see where our potential for the coming years lies and consciously demand, promote and develop it. Now the weak vintages are coming to the Mart and the "war for talent" is becoming more demanding than ever with skilled gastronomy professionals. We systematically check with our management where there is potential, consider which steps make sense for our business and support these employees. We'd like to bring in people from our own ranks. We achieve much more than with wages with good working conditions, in which we take all possible safety measures and adhere to the corresponding specifications. Not as a "must", but because we want to shape and improve the field of work. We regularly review employment contracts to determine whether they make sense. Flexibility in operation is extremely important, but should be achieved above all through meticulous organisation and regular work and shift planning. No jobs are created for employees, but we attach importance to finding the best and most satisfactory solutions. Extraordinary performance is rewarded with a large number of bonuses and team awards. In the 2016/2017 FY, for example, 18 "Be a star" Award companies were rewarded with 18 brave prizes. 20 November 2017

Canteen staff Washing/cleaning/cash register Working hours: Working hours cannot be written down completely, employees regularly have to work 15 to 30 minutes longer, canteen closes at 4 p.m., cleaning has to be done by 4:20 p.m. Guided tour of the canteen Very condescending, health problems are ridiculed when a doctor orders remedies against aggravation of health problems, the competence of the doctor was questioned. Dealing with sick days problematic, due to too scarce personnel resources one does not dare to be ill, only if one must vomit or obviously has a fever, one may go home or stay. Guide handle temporarily offensive, often condescending.
